Hello,
I created a dashboard and it is almost complete! I'm just looking to edit the calculated measure shown below so that it represents Fiscal Year-to-Date (that begins Dec 1 to Nov 30 every year), instead of just the last 12 months.
YTD Actuals = CALCULATE ( SUM ( 'finance ExpensesWithAccountDescriptions '[ Total Amount ] ), DATESINPERIOD ( ' New Calender Table '[ Dates ], today () , -1 , YEAR ))
Also, the "today()" portion is not syncing with the slicer. The data remains the same no matter what date I select on the slicer, even though the other columns all make the adjustments.

@dtango9 , Dateytd can take end date of year
YTD Sales = CALCULATE(SUM(Sales[Sales Amount]),DATESYTD('Date'[Date],"11/30"))
Last YTD Sales = CALCULATE(SUM(Sales[Sales Amount]),DATESYTD(dateadd('Date'[Date],-1,Year),"11/30"))
YTD QTY forced=
var _max1 = today() //or maxx(allselected('Order'),'order'[Date])
var _max = format(_max,"MMDD")
return
calculate(Sum('order'[Qty]),DATESYTD('Date'[Date],"11/30"),filter('Date', format('Date'[Date],"MMDD")<=_max))
YTD QTY forced=
var _max = today()
return
if(max('Date'[Date])<=_max, calculate(Sum('order'[Qty]),DATESYTD('Date'[Date],"11/30")), blank())
//or
//calculate(Sum('order'[Qty]),DATESYTD('Date'[Date],"11/30"),filter('Date','Date'[Date]<=_max))
//calculate(TOTALYTD(Sum('order'[Qty]),'Date'[Date],"11/30"),filter('Date','Date'[Date]<=_max))
LYTD QTY forced=
var _max = date(year(today())-1,month(today()),day(today()))
return
if(max('Date'[Date])<=_max, CALCULATE(Sum('order'[Qty]),DATESYTD(dateadd('Date'[Date],-1,year),"11/30"),'Date'[Date]<=_max), blank())
//OR
//CALCULATE(Sum('order'[Qty]),DATESYTD(dateadd('Date'[Date],-1,year),"11/30"),'Date'[Date]<=_max)
